What is Permaculture?
Permaculture is an approach to agriculture that focuses on creating self-sustaining ecosystems that mimic natural systems. It puts emphasis on designing agricultural systems that work with nature rather than against it. The goal of permaculture is to create resilient and regenerative food systems that can sustain themselves for generations.
What are the Main Permaculture Design Principles?
There are several permaculture design principles, but here are some of the most important ones:
1. Observe and interact
Before starting any project or making any changes, it’s crucial to observe and understand how things work in your environment. Take time to study your land, climate, soil type, water sources, vegetation coverages among other factors affecting crop production.
2. Catch and store energy
One critical aspect of sustainability is energy management. Harvesting rainwater through catchment systems such as gutters directing water into tanks or underground storage facilities like boreholes will ensure constant availability during dry seasons
3. Obtain a yield
Growing produce isn’t just about sustainability; it’s also about feeding yourself and others around you with nutritious foods from your farm or garden.
4. Apply self-regulation & accept feedback:
The ecosystem has natural checks & balances which ensures stability over time even when external factors change – regulating use of resources such as irrigation schemes,, fertilizers etc . Accepting feedback means being open-minded enough to listen and learn from the environment.
5. Use and value renewable resources
By using renewable resources, such as sunlight, wind energy, or water sources that replenish themselves over time, you can reduce your dependence on non-renewable resources like fossil fuels.
6. Produce no waste
Waste reduction is a critical part of sustainable agriculture practices. You can recycle organic waste by composting it and use it to enrich your soil naturally.
7. Design from patterns to details
The overall pattern should come first before specific details are incorporated into the design. The overarching goal is to create a system that works in harmony with nature.
How Can Permaculture Principles Help Grow Produce Locally?
Permaculture principles can help you grow produce locally in several ways:
1. Soil Improvement:
Permaculture principles prioritize improving soil health through natural methods instead of artificial fertilizers which have negative environmental impacts . By building healthy soils through companion planting and crop rotation techniques , it ensures long-term sustainability of the farm
2. Water Management:
Water management plays a crucial role in permaculture farming practices since crops require consistent moisture levels for growth throughout their life cycles. Practices such as contour farming, swales or terracing help regulate water flow reducing erosion while increasing water retention capacity .
3.Composting:
Composting is an essential aspect of permaculture agriculture since organic wastes provide nutrients for plants while also reducing greenhouse gas emissions associated with landfill disposal . Composted materials such as food scraps, leaves & manure serve as nourishment for plants creating healthy soils leading to increased yields
4.Pest Control:
Permaculturists employ natural means such as intercropping with aromatic plants or strategic placement of insectary habitats which attract beneficial insects thus controlling pests without using toxic pesticides harmful both humans & environment
5.Diversity :
Diversity is key because monocropping has been known to lead not only lower yields but also increased incidences pest outbreaks. Permaculture principles encourage planting of diverse crops to create a balanced ecosystem.
What are Some Examples of Permaculture Practices for Growing Produce Locally?
Some examples of permaculture practices for growing produce locally include:
1. Companion Planting:
Companion planting involves intercropping different plant species in close proximity to one another, where they can mutually benefit from each other through increased pollination or pest control.
2. Polycultures:
Polycultures involve the cultivation of multiple crop species in a single area, which creates a more complex and resilient ecosystem that can support many different kinds of organisms.
3. Agroforestry:
Agroforestry is an approach that combines trees with crops or livestock production, creating a symbiotic relationship between the two systems while improving soil health and water retention capacity
4. Aquaponics:
Aquaponics is an innovative system that combines fish farming with hydroponic gardening-where plants grow directly in nutrient-rich water rather than soil . This method reduces water usage while enhancing yields since fish waste serves as fertilizer for plants
5. Keyhole Gardens:
Keyhole gardens are raised circular beds surrounded by stones or bricks and feature compost bins at their center . They are efficient in terms of space utilization & natural resource conservation especially on small plots land .
